48 grams 12cm^3, what would the density of the material be

Density is mass over volume:

[tex]D = \frac{m}{V} [/tex]

In your case, mass is 48 grams and volume is 12cm^3

If you put that into the equation, you will get your density:

[tex]D = \frac{m}{V} = \frac{48g}{12cm^{3} } =4g/ cm^{3} [/tex]
